Catalogue Note
While it is unknown whether Siberechts actually visited Italy, the strong Italian influence in the present painting can in any case be put down to a knowledge of the Dutch Italianate paintings that he would have seen in Antwerp. The present work can be dated prior to Siberecht's journey to England in 1673 when his style reflected both his Flemish roots and the fashion for warmly lit landscapes in the Italian tradition.
